The Types and Causes of Water Damage

Water damage can be categorized into three main types based on the source and level of contamination: clean water, gray water, and black water.

  1. Clean Water Damage

Clean water damage refers to water that originates from a clean source and does not pose an immediate health risk. The common causes are:

  • Burst Pipes: Freezing temperatures, aging pipes, or excessive pressure can cause pipes to burst, leading to the release of clean water into your property.
  • Plumbing Leaks: Leaky faucets, faulty supply lines, or damaged plumbing fixtures can result in clean water leaks that gradually cause damage over time.
  • Appliance Malfunctions: Malfunctioning washing machines, dishwashers, or water heaters can release clean water and cause damage to nearby areas.

  1. Gray Water Damage

Gray water damage refers to water that may contain contaminants and poses a moderate health risk. It originates from sources such as:

  • Sinks and Showers: Water from sinks, showers, and washing machines can be classified as gray water. Although it may contain traces of soap, detergents, or mild chemicals, it is not heavily contaminated.
  • Overflowing Bathtubs or Toilets: When bathtubs or toilets overflow without the presence of fecal matter, the resulting water can be classified as gray water.

  1. Black Water Damage

Black water damage is the most serious and dangerous type of water damage. It is highly contaminated and poses significant health risks. Sources of black water include:

  • Sewage Backups: Sewage backups occur when the wastewater from toilets, drains, or sewers overflows into your property. The water contains fecal matter, harmful bacteria, and other hazardous contaminants.
  • Floodwater: Floods caused by natural disasters or heavy rainfall can introduce black water into your property. It can contain a wide range of contaminants, including chemicals, bacteria, and debris.

Understanding the types of water damage is essential for assessing the level of contamination and implementing appropriate restoration measures.

Common Causes of Water Damage

floods

Water damage can result from various causes, some of which are more prevalent than others. By identifying these causes, you can take preventive measures to minimize the risk of water damage to your property. Here are some common causes:

a) Floods. Natural disasters such as hurricanes, heavy rainfall, or river overflows can cause widespread flooding, leading to significant water damage.

b) Plumbing Issues. Faulty or aging plumbing systems can develop leaks, burst pipes, or joint failures, resulting in water damage within your property.

c) Roof Leaks. Damaged or improperly installed roofs can allow water to seep into the building during rainstorms, leading to interior water damage.

d) Appliance Failures. Malfunctioning appliances like washing machines, dishwashers, refrigerators, or water heaters can leak or overflow, causing water damage in the surrounding areas.

e) HVAC System Issues. Improperly maintained or faulty HVAC systems can lead to condensation buildup, pipe leaks, or water overflow, resulting in water damage.

f) Poor Drainage. Inadequate or blocked drainage systems around your property can cause water to accumulate, leading to water damage in basements, crawl spaces, or foundation walls.

The Effects of Water Damage

Water damage can cause significant problems for both your property and your health. It’s important to take action quickly to prevent further damage and minimize health risks.

  1. Structural Damage: Water weakens your property’s structure, leading to warping, rotting, and collapsing. This makes your property unstable and restoration more costly.
  1. Mold Growth: Water creates an ideal environment for mold, which can cause allergies, and respiratory issues, and worsen asthma symptoms. Acting fast and drying affected areas is crucial to prevent mold growth and health risks.
  1. Electrical Hazards: Water and electricity don’t mix. Water damage can lead to short circuits, power outages, and electrical fires. Turn off the power and get professional help for safety.
  1. Health Risks: Water damage breeds harmful microorganisms that can cause skin irritations, infections, and allergies. Prompt action, thorough drying, and disinfection reduce health hazards.
  1. Importance of Acting Quickly: Acting promptly prevents further damage and health risks. Delaying worsens structural damage and increases the chance of mold growth. Professional water extraction helps minimize damage.

Understanding the effects of water damage emphasizes the need to act promptly and seek professional help to minimize damage and restore your property effectively.

The Importance of Water Extraction Services

Water extraction services are crucial in various situations where water damage has occurred. Here are some reasons highlighting the importance of these services:

  1. Preventing Structural Damage. Excess water, whether from a flood, burst pipe, or any other source, can penetrate and saturate building materials such as walls, floors, and foundations. This can lead to structural instability, weakening the integrity of the property over time. Water extraction professionals have the necessary tools and techniques to remove water efficiently, preventing further damage to the structure.
  1. Minimizing Mold Growth. Moisture provides an ideal environment for mold and mildew to thrive. If water damage is not addressed promptly, the excess moisture can promote mold growth within 24 to 48 hours. Mold not only damages surfaces but also poses significant health risks, especially for individuals with respiratory issues or allergies. By promptly extracting water, professionals can eliminate excess moisture and reduce the risk of mold growth, helping to maintain a safe and healthy environment.
  1. Salvaging Belongings. Water damage can wreak havoc on personal belongings, including furniture, electronics, important documents, and sentimental items. Water extraction services aim to salvage and restore as many items as possible. The professionals have the expertise and techniques to carefully handle and dry affected belongings, minimizing financial losses and preserving sentimental value.
  1. Faster Restoration Process. Water extraction specialists are equipped with state-of-the-art equipment designed to efficiently remove standing water. By quickly extracting the water, they can expedite the drying and dehumidification stages of the restoration process. This not only reduces overall restoration time but also helps prevent secondary damage, such as mold growth or further structural deterioration.
